Train up a child in the way he should go: and when he is old, he will not depart from it. Proverbs 22:6 KJV The experience of having one or more teenagers living in your home can be exciting and exhausting at the same time. This book addresses the realization that it can also be a very rewarding experience. Before They Graduate is a simple, fast and informative read; a pro-active approach to your child’s future, while training them up in the way he or she should go. Every teenager, at one time or another seems to think they already know everything they need to know about growing up. However, most teenagers are craving guidance and encouragement from their loved ones, as they tackle life’s difficult transition into adulthood. As you read Before They Graduate, you will discover the creative steps Cheryl, and her husband Gary, implemented while training up their own children. Allowing each child to be actively responsible for his or her own future has proven to be a winning formula and a beautiful testament to the loving, respectful relationship they continue to have with each of their children. Parents with a child of any age, can benefit from Cheryl’s personal experiences, highlighted struggles, and the blessings she continues to enjoy as a mother whose four children are as different from each other as night is from day. God bless you as you get to know Cheryl’s heart for you and your child, as you enter a season of life where what you do now will have a significant impact on your child’s future…Before They Graduate.
